目的:建立痛风颗粒的质量标准。方法:采用薄层色谱(TLC)法对方中薏苡仁、赤芍、甘草进行定性鉴别;采用高效液相色谱-蒸发光散射检测法测定知母中有效成分菝葜皂苷元的含量。结果:TLC特征明显、专属性强;菝葜皂苷元进样量在0.546~4.368μg范围内与峰面积积分值呈良好的线性关系(r=0.9998);平均回收率为97.74%,RSD=1.3%(n=6)。结论:所建标准可用于痛风颗粒的质量控制。
Objective: To establish the quality standard of gout particles. Methods: TLC method was used to qualitatively identify coixenolide, radix paeoniae, and licorice. The content of saponins in Zhimu was determined by high performance liquid chromatography-evaporative light scattering detection. RESULTS: The characteristics of TLC were obvious and the specificity was strong. There was a good linear relationship (r=0.9998) between the range of 0.546~4.368 μg and the integral value of the triterpenoid saponin injection. The average recovery rate was 97.74%, and the RSD was 1.3. % (n=6). Conclusion: The established standard can be used for quality control of gout particles.
